Abstract
Aims: To determine the prognostic value of baseline plasma adiponectin levels in patients with known or suspected coronary artery disease referred for coronary angiography. Methods and results: Adiponectin was measured in 325 male patients with stable angina, troponin-negative unstable angina, and non-ST-segment elevation myocardial infarction (MI) undergoing coronary angiography at a Veterans Administration Medical Center. The patients were then followed prospectively for the occurrence of all-cause mortality, cardiac mortality, and MI. Follow-up data at 24 months were available for 97% of the patients. Adiponectin was the only biomarker to independently predict the individual endpoints of all-cause mortality, cardiac mortality, and MI. The 24-month survival rates for patients in the lower (≤4.431 mg/L), middle (>4.431 and ≤8.008 mg/L), and upper (>8.008 mg/L) tertiles of plasma adiponectin values were 95.0, 90.4, and 83.5%, respectively (P=0.0232 by log-rank test). Furthermore, when patients with chest pain were risk-stratified into those with and without a non-ST-segment elevation acute coronary syndrome (NSTEACS), adiponectin remained an independent predictor of both all-cause mortality and cardiac mortality in the NSTEACS subgroup. Conclusion: In a cohort of male patients undergoing coronary angiography, a single baseline determination of plasma adiponectin is independently predictive of the subsequent risk of death and MI. © The European Society of Cardiology 2006.
